Japanese multimedia entertainment group Marvelous is currently seeking voluntary retirement from around twenty of its staff.

The company states that this target range for voluntary retirement accounts for around 17 percent of its workforce. A severance package has been prepared for those twenty workers, but will only be available for those who decide to retire before April 3.

Staff will officially retire on April 30 if they volunteer. It is not known what measures the management will take if voluntary retirement targets are not met.

Marvelous was recently confirmed as the publisher for Suda51’s next No More Heroes title in Japan. The company has a North American co-publishing contract with XSEED Games, and also has interests in the London-based joint venture Rising Star Games.
